A seismic shift is underway in global politics, triggered by a decisive move from the United States to withdraw from dozens of international organizations. This isn’t a quiet retreat; it’s a forceful recalibration of American foreign policy, sending shockwaves through the European Union.

The reaction from EU leaders has been unusually charged, bordering on alarm. Germany’s President Frank-Walter Steinmeier delivered a scathing rebuke, accusing the US of “destroying the world order” – language typically reserved for adversaries, not allies. His words painted a stark picture of a descent into global lawlessness.

Steinmeier went further, equating America’s actions to Russia’s invasion of Ukraine, a claim that ignited debate and underscored the depth of the perceived crisis. He warned of a future dominated by “unscrupulous” powers, a future he believes the US is actively courting.

The Trump administration views many of these organizations as bloated, ineffective, and driven by a left-leaning agenda that doesn’t serve American interests. They prioritize national sovereignty and fiscal responsibility.

The US withdrawal encompasses a wide range of UN-affiliated bodies, including those focused on population, women’s issues, climate change, and democracy promotion. It also extends to non-UN organizations, signaling a broad rejection of what officials describe as “ideological capture.”

The State Department has been explicit about this change in direction, citing a “globalist, ideological agenda” and a prioritization of “America First” as reasons for withdrawing from organizations like UNESCO. Continued membership, they argue, simply no longer serves the national interest.

Steinmeier’s call for Germany to eliminate its military “deficits” and assert itself as a hard-power actor adds another layer to the unfolding drama. It reveals a growing recognition within Germany that it must be prepared to take on a greater role in a world where American leadership is being questioned.
